>  I understand you are having problems with the Abit AV8 motherboard paired
> with the AMD 64 3400+ cpu, well, for one obvious problem I see is the
> motherboard and cpu mismatch.
> The Abit AV8 motherboard is a 939 socket, the AMD 3400+ is a 754
> socket, while the cpu may fit on the mobo you won't be able to use the
> dual channel memory feature and I suspect the mismatch would cause other
> problems as well. TigerDirect is also selling the motherboard combo
> and fail to mention the socket for the cpu. One would assume the cpu is
> also a 939 pin but it isn't.  the dual channel  memory PC3200 latency
> and voltage must also match your mobo.. I am searching the internet
> for a good 939 mobo, and Abit AV8 and the Asus A8V get high marks.
> hope this helps some     Gary

There are places selling cpu/motherboard combos where the sockets don't
match?  What kind of idiots would they have to be to do that?

I must admit amd's website does not list a 3400 that isn't socket 754,
so that would be a problem for a socket 939 board.
